Israel Slams Bolivia, Chile, Colombia Over Diplomatic Moves

Israel has criticized Bolivia, Chile, and Colombia for their diplomatic moves to protest Israel's military operations against Hamas in Gaza. The South American countries have recalled their ambassadors to Israel and condemned the killing of civilians in Gaza.

Bolivia Severs Diplomatic Ties with Israel

Bolivia's decision to sever diplomatic ties with Israel has been condemned by Israel as a "surrender to terrorism." Bolivia had previously severed diplomatic ties with Israel in 2009 only to resume them in 2020.

Chile and Colombia Recall Ambassadors

Chile and Colombia have both recalled their ambassadors to Israel in protest of the killing of civilians in Gaza. Chile's President Gabriel Boric has condemned the attacks and kidnappings perpetrated by Hamas, but he has also said that "innocent civilians" are the "main victims of Israel's offensive."

Colombia's President Condemns Israel's Actions

Colombia's President Gustavo Petro has been more direct in his criticism of Israel's actions, calling them "genocide" and accusing Israel of trying to remove the Palestinian people from Gaza and take it over.

Argentina and Brazil Criticize Israel

Argentina and Brazil have also criticized Israel's military activity in Gaza. Argentina has condemned the attack in the Jabaliya refugee camp and said the "humanitarian situation in Gaza is ever more alarming." Brazil's President Luiz Inacio Lula da Silva has called on Israel to end its bombing of Gaza.

Jewish Human Rights Organization Condemns Bolivia, Chile, and Colombia

The Simon Wiesenthal Center, a Jewish human rights organization, has criticized Bolivia, Chile, and Colombia for their diplomatic moves. The center has accused Bolivia of aligning itself with Iran and called the decision by Colombia and Chile to recall their ambassadors "a clearly coordinated action."

The diplomatic moves by Bolivia, Chile, and Colombia are a sign of the growing criticism of Israel's military activity in Gaza. These countries are joining a chorus of voices calling on Israel to end its bombing of Gaza and to respect international humanitarian law.
